Outbreak of World War I

In order to see this content you need to have both Javascript enabled and Flash installed. Visit BBC Webwise for full instructions

Interviewees remembering their emotions when the First World War began.

Interviewees remembering where they were when the start of the First World War was announced in 1914 and their feelings at the time.

Teachers' notes

Age Group : 11-14,14-16, 16+

Subject : History

Topic : Twentieth century world

Keywords : First World War

Notes : Use clip in the study of the First World War - Key Stages 3, 4 and 5. Use as stimulus to class discussion - ask pupils for their reactions to the horrors of the war. How would these interviewees have felt at this time? Compare with other wars.
